What Is Cannabis Vaping? A Quick Primer
Cannabis vaping involves heating a cannabis concentrate or extract to a temperature high enough to vaporize its active compounds — primarily cannabinoids like THC and CBD, along with aromatic terpenes — without combusting the plant material itself. Because no combustion occurs, vaping generally produces fewer toxic byproducts than smoking.
The hardware typically consists of a battery (often called a 510-thread battery or a proprietary pod device) and a cartridge or pod pre-filled with cannabis oil. When you draw from the device, the battery heats a ceramic or metal coil that warms the oil to vaporization temperature — usually between 315°F and 450°F (157°C–232°C).
What is inside that cartridge, however, is where distillate and live resin part ways entirely.
Cannabis Distillate: The High-Potency Standard
How Distillate Is Made
Cannabis distillate is produced through a multi-step refinement process that begins with dried and cured cannabis flower or trim. The starting material is first extracted using a solvent (commonly CO2, ethanol, or butane), producing a raw crude oil. That crude oil then undergoes a process called short-path or wiped-film distillation.
Distillation works by applying precise heat under vacuum conditions, which allows individual cannabinoid molecules to be separated by their unique boiling points. The result is an extraordinarily pure, viscous oil — typically reaching 85 to 99 percent THC or CBD by weight.
There is a significant tradeoff embedded in that purity: the distillation process also strips away the vast majority of terpenes, flavonoids, and minor cannabinoids that contribute to the plant's complex aroma, flavor, and holistic effects. Most distillate is essentially odorless and tasteless in its base state.
Terpenes in Distillate: Added Back In
To compensate for terpene loss, distillate cartridge manufacturers typically add terpenes back into the final product after distillation. These added terpenes fall into two categories: cannabis-derived terpenes (CDTs), which are isolated from cannabis plants, and botanically derived terpenes (BDTs), which are sourced from other plants like lavender, oranges, or pine trees. CDTs are considered higher quality; BDTs are more common in budget products.
The practical result is a product whose flavor profile ranges from mild and functional (budget distillate with BDTs) to surprisingly nuanced (premium distillate with CDTs) — but never quite as authentic as a true full-spectrum extract.
The Distillate Experience
Distillate delivers powerful, fast-acting effects driven primarily by THC. Because the oil is highly refined, the effects tend to be clean and predictable. Many consumers describe distillate highs as more "heady" or cerebral, though much depends on whether any minor cannabinoids remain in the product.
Best for: Consumers prioritizing maximum potency, discretion (minimal odor), consistent dosing, and value for money.
Live Resin: Full-Spectrum Freshness
How Live Resin Is Made
Live resin is defined by its starting material. Instead of dried and cured cannabis, live resin is made from freshly harvested cannabis plants that have been flash-frozen immediately after cutting — often within minutes — using liquid nitrogen or a commercial flash freezer. The plants stay frozen throughout the entire extraction process.
This critical difference in starting material preservation is what separates live resin from every other concentrate category. Drying and curing cannabis causes significant terpene degradation — studies suggest that up to 55 percent of a plant's terpenes can be lost during the drying process. By keeping the plant frozen, live resin captures the complete terpene profile of the living plant, including many delicate compounds that would otherwise evaporate.
Extraction typically uses hydrocarbon solvents (usually butane or propane) at cold temperatures. The solvent is then purged through controlled heat under vacuum, leaving behind a rich, aromatic concentrate that can range in texture from a runny oil to a crystalline sauce, depending on the specific processing method.
The Terpene Advantage: The Entourage Effect
The reason cannabis connoisseurs are willing to pay a premium for live resin comes down to two words: entourage effect. This widely discussed concept in cannabis science refers to the synergistic interaction between cannabinoids, terpenes, flavonoids, and other phytochemicals naturally present in the cannabis plant.
The theory — supported by a growing body of preclinical research — holds that whole-plant or full-spectrum extracts produce more nuanced, balanced, and therapeutically complex effects than isolated compounds alone. Terpenes like myrcene, limonene, linalool, and beta-caryophyllene are not just aromatic molecules; they interact with cannabinoid receptors and influence how THC and CBD are metabolized and felt.
Live resin preserves this entire chemical orchestra. Distillate, by contrast, performs a stripped-down solo.
The Live Resin Experience
Consumers consistently describe live resin experiences as more layered, more body-present, and more true to the character of the original cannabis strain. Flavor is dramatically more pronounced — you can genuinely taste the difference between a Zkittlez live resin and a Sour Diesel live resin in the way you cannot with distillate.
Effects tend to feel more dynamic and strain-specific. A sativa-leaning live resin may feel genuinely energizing in a way a sativa-labeled distillate often does not, because the terpene complement that shapes those sativa characteristics is actually present.
Best for: Flavor-forward consumers, experienced users seeking strain-specific effects, medical patients interested in full-spectrum benefits, and cannabis connoisseurs.
Distillate vs Live Resin: Side-by-Side Comparison
Factor | Cannabis Distillate | Live Resin |
Source Material | Dried/cured cannabis | Fresh-frozen cannabis |
Extraction Method | Distillation | Hydrocarbon / BHO / CO2 |
THC Potency | 85-99%+ | 45-85% |
Terpene Profile | Stripped (added back) | Full-spectrum, natural |
Flavor | Neutral / mild | Rich, strain-accurate |
Entourage Effect | Reduced | Full / enhanced |
Consistency | Clear oil, very uniform | Oily to waxy / varied |
Price Point | Lower cost | Premium price |
Best For | High potency, discretion | Flavor chasers, connoisseurs |
Hardware Considerations: Does Your Device Matter?
Yes — and this is an underappreciated aspect of the vaping experience. The hardware you use affects vapor quality, terpene preservation, and overall satisfaction regardless of which concentrate type you choose. live resin vs distillate
Temperature Control
Terpenes are volatile at higher temperatures, meaning aggressive heat settings literally burn off the aromatic compounds before you inhale them. For live resin specifically, lower temperature settings (in the 315-370°F / 157-188°C range) tend to deliver much richer flavor. Many premium battery devices now offer variable voltage or temperature control settings — a worthwhile investment if you are buying live resin cartridges.
Distillate, being already stripped of many terpenes, is more heat-tolerant and performs adequately on standard fixed-voltage batteries.
Cartridge Quality and Coil Material
- Ceramic coils are generally preferred for live resin — they heat more evenly and avoid the metallic taste that can come from older wick-based or cotton-core systems.
- Glass or quartz cartridge bodies preserve terpene integrity better than plastic, which can leach compounds and alter flavor over time.
- Proprietary pod systems (like those from Pax, CCELL, or brand-specific hardware) often outperform generic 510 carts in terms of vapor consistency and cartridge seal quality.
- Check for lab-tested hardware, especially regarding heavy metals. In legal markets, reputable brands publish Certificate of Analysis documents covering both the concentrate and the hardware.
Price, Availability, and Legal Market Considerations
Understanding the Price Gap
Live resin commands a significant price premium over distillate across virtually every legal cannabis market — typically 30 to 70 percent more per gram. This reflects several real cost differences: fresh-frozen biomass requires more careful logistics and handling; cold hydrocarbon extraction is more technically complex and equipment-intensive; and live resin yields per pound of starting material are lower than distillate yields.
Distillate's lower price point reflects its efficiency: distillation can process large volumes of lower-grade starting material (trim, shake, biomass) into consistent high-potency oil at scale. That efficiency makes distillate the backbone of the mass market vape cart industry.

Frequently Asked Questions
Is live resin stronger than distillate?
Not necessarily by THC percentage — distillate routinely tests higher in raw THC content (85-99%+ versus live resin's 45-85%). However, many consumers report that live resin feels more potent in practice, potentially due to the entourage effect enhancing how THC is experienced. Potency is not just about THC percentage.
Does live resin smell more than distillate when vaping?
Yes, noticeably. Live resin's full terpene profile produces a much more pronounced and identifiable cannabis aroma both during and after vaping. Distillate with BDTs produces minimal odor; distillate with CDTs produces moderate odor. If discretion is important, distillate is the better option.
Can I use any battery with a live resin cartridge?
Most live resin cartridges use the standard 510-thread connection and are compatible with most 510 batteries. However, for the best live resin experience, a variable-voltage battery set to a lower temperature (2.4-3.0V, or roughly 315-370°F) will significantly improve flavor and terpene preservation compared to a high-voltage fixed battery.
What is live rosin, and how does it differ from live resin?
Live rosin is a solventless concentrate made from live (fresh-frozen) or fresh cannabis using only heat and pressure — no chemical solvents are involved. It represents the highest tier of craft cannabis extraction and commands the highest prices. Live resin uses hydrocarbon solvents (properly purged) to achieve its full-spectrum extraction. Both offer excellent terpene preservation compared to distillate; live rosin simply does so without any solvent involvement.
Are there health differences between vaping distillate and live resin?
Both products, when purchased from licensed dispensaries with current lab test results in regulated markets, have undergone safety testing for residual solvents, pesticides, and heavy metals. The 2019-2020 EVALI (e-cigarette or vaping product use-associated lung injury) outbreak was primarily linked to vitamin E acetate used as a cutting agent in illicit, unregulated cartridges — not to legitimate licensed market products. Always purchase from licensed, tested sources regardless of which type you choose.
